I also knew Dr. Gardner in that time frame. I had the responsibility
for the specification and procurement of the Saturn V com system.
It included a phase locked turn around offset transponder for Doppler
tracking.
Also forward command and return telemetry. To gain some knowledge
of phase locked systems I contracted Dr. Gardner to conduct a course
on phase locked techniques at MSFC. This course became the basis
for his book. He gave me a signed copy.
